閱讀613 返回首頁    go 技術社區[雲棲]


DataV可視化大屏提升數據匯總效率,緊抓商機

要解決這個問題,必須搭建一塊實時數據看板

3年前,計算機博士鄧毓博辭去高校教職,創業做起“互聯網+牛肉麵”的生意——生產標準化的速食牛肉麵,放上淘寶售賣。他的品牌“牛大坊”,剛開張第一年就賣出了20多萬份麵,但他並不滿足於此。


_


鄧毓博的終極理想,是用“雲供應鏈”整合牛肉麵產業的各個環節,革新線下店鋪的經營模式,讓蘭州牛肉麵與麥當勞、肯德基一樣,標準化。2016年下半年,鄧毓博帶著這個想法找到好友老財,老財經營的包菜網絡是家技術解決方案公司,過去兩年協助大量餐飲連鎖店完成信息化改造,兩人一拍即合。於是,鄧毓博的網紅牛肉麵團隊,正式轉型做起供應鏈服務。

改造的第一步,就是讓街邊的牛肉麵實體店鋪變得智能,裝上了三大係統提升效率:點單支付和收銀係統、CRM 用戶管理係統、ERP 庫存控製係統。**留存在上述係統裏的銷售數據,過去都是各個門店自己做盤點,再由店長上報到總部的運營部門做匯總,鏈路過長且容易出錯。**對分秒必爭的供應商來說,減少數據匯總的時間損耗,正是商機所在。鄧毓博和老財認定,要解決這個問題,必須搭建一塊實時數據看板。



奮鬥半個月終於整出了原型,卻發現這是個大坑

老財聯想到天貓雙十一交易數據大屏,何不把牛肉麵的實時銷售搬上大屏幕,這樣也方便業務人員即時監控與調整。於是,前端同學照著雙十一大屏悶頭開發起來,奮鬥半個月終於整出了原型,卻發現這是個大坑,數據大屏對技術要求非常高,要做到商業化應用, 開發成本相當高,粗略算下來至少要150人日。

這還沒算後續的運維和更新,以及一些更現實的問題:
·麵對高速增長的業務需求,這樣的時間人力成本是很大的負擔;
·數據可視化的設計和實現都比較困難,要做到性能和效果都OK的程度,對於複雜數據的設計展現還是有很高專業要求的;
·設計出來的很多圖表與特效對於本來就任務繁重的開發同學更是耗時耗力,大屏幕上分辨率適配的種種問題也很麻煩。


為了理想方案反複選型,不僅限於效果炫酷
於是老財開始反複比較和選擇相關數據展現的產品和工具,數據可視化不能僅限於效果好看,作為企業應用選型,我們需要考慮長期與實際業務場景的結合匹配度,數據展示是否回答業務問題,影響決策,才是真的產生價值。

對於我們來說,理想的數據看板需要實現三個功能:
1、數據實時 2、可視化 3、一屏展現多個指標。

這3點看起來容易,實際需要考慮的事情還是很繁瑣的,比如:

1.數據實時:
為了實現實時數據展現,必須要實時提供公司的業務數據,這就需要足夠安全、穩定的雲服務做基礎,這是我們必須考慮的根本問題。
2.可視化:
既然要做數據看板,為的是脫離枯燥的數據表,動態地看到數據變化和趨勢,對於數據展現的效果肯定是有一定要求的,美觀和實用的平衡度也是極重要的。
3.一屏展現多個指標:
對於各個指標的數據展示,我們有各種細分的需求,這需要相當豐富的組件庫,最好還能讓不同的組件能聯動起來展示,這樣就能完成初步的數據鑽取了!



正當犯難之際,老財發現阿裏雲 DataV 正是雙十一數據大屏的搭建工具,在 DataV 裏靠拖拽組件和簡單數據配置,就能做出同樣的效果。考慮到雲服務的安全和穩定性,加上DataV為業務需求誕生的基因,我們對這個產品的實用度還是比較有信心的。很快,技術方案敲定,DataV 作為牛肉麵數據大屏的前端展示,對接智能門店係統後台數據。


72f9ce9db44cfa759d1dc0f737bf1b847fab21fb
(圖1:蘭州牛肉麵數據大屏截圖。數據大屏鏈接:https://datav.aliyun.com/share/470b65372324f45b7ecd0b63f5abab11


基礎版 ?企業版?


_
(圖2: DataV 的各版本區別)


來到dataV的購買頁,發現還要做版本選擇,各種細化的對比一不小心就看花眼了,為了先測試一下是否好用,還是先選擇了基礎版,讓前端同學上手試著搭建了一個大屏試了試。


第一個大屏1小時內就搭建好了,後來發現大屏的分享安全性是個很嚴肅的問題,通過比較發現企業版能夠加密分享,考慮到企業長期使用的穩定性,為了企業的業務數據安全分享,減少麻煩,最後還是決定升級為企業版更安心一些。


step4_

另一方麵,**老板特別要求了:“一屏要能展現多個指標”,**對於各個指標的數據展示,各種細分的使用場景是不同的,而且隨著業務的發展,未來會有更高的要求,這需要相當豐富、並且不斷更新的組件庫,最好還能讓不同的組件能聯動起來展示,這樣就能完成初步的數據鑽取了!

前端同學發現,企業版在數據源的選項、大屏項目數量、組件的豐富度都遠遠高於基礎版的配置,考慮到業務快速發展的需求,多樣化的數據源和強大的組件庫這塊也是我們升級企業版的重要原因。


從0到1的DataV數據可視化大屏搭建經驗


數據準備:搞定數據來源和數據加工
技術團隊采用了阿裏雲數加的全套方案,首先通過實時采集腳本,定時執行采集任務,通過阿裏雲的多數據源數據同步能力,把相關業務數據抽取出來,確保時效性,又不影響正在發生的當前業務。接著在數據應用層通過腳本實時運算,匯總成用於最終顯示的數據模型。再通過接口把要顯示的可視化前端組件數據通過 API 的方式和 DataV 對接即可。

使用API的方式,可以穩定的對外提供接口,保證數據輸出的統一性。比如,飛線處理,需要把交易的實時發生地動態轉化成坐標,這裏技術團隊用到了高德地圖的服務。假設需要換成其他服務商,隻需改動API內部的邏輯代碼,對數據展示層來說無需變化,這極大地保證了穩定性 。**另外,選擇由服務器發起http代理請求,也解決了跨域等問題,DataV 的設計考慮到了不同場景的需要。**
ebb83fe183c71d32301060c9750e043dbe4a37c9
(圖3:蘭州牛肉麵數據大屏技術架構圖)

根據業務需求,拖拽組件:

牛大坊數據大屏主要使用了翻牌器、支付地圖,物料庫存柱狀圖,實時排名列表,扇形百分比等組件。
ac25908860e1a1e3e5b47524f8d133048b9b935b
(圖4:使用 DataV 製作蘭州牛肉麵大屏的界麵)


通過交易地圖以及套餐實時交易排行榜,能夠實時掌握各區域銷售情況和各品類銷售情況,方便實時跟蹤目標進度,調整策略等。**通過物料庫存柱狀百分比組件,相關人員隨時看看大屏就能知道各個區域的物料消耗情況,提前進行部署和庫存調度,大幅減少損耗,高效提前備貨。**

(小編備注:更多上手文檔,迅速開始
https://help.aliyun.com/document_detail/53845.html?spm=5176.doc53844.6.543.RP8JNp)



解放開發同學,運營人員也不再苦等各門店的數據匯總


蘭州牛肉麵數據大屏誕生後,極大提升了牛大坊的運營效率,現在鄧毓博的運營人員不再苦等各門店的數據匯總。每天上班,看看大屏,就能知道各個區域的物料消耗情況,提前進行部署和庫存調度,大幅減少損耗,甚至很多時候,比門店還提前知道備貨量。

嚐到甜頭後,鄧毓博堅定了深耕數據化標準化運營的決心。同時,蘭州牛肉麵協會也向當地商務局推薦了這個數據大屏,希望能應用到更多的領域。

----------這一天已經不遠了,未來你在路邊吃的每碗蘭州牛肉麵背後,都會藏著大數據的力量。此刻我隻想問,黃燜雞、麻辣燙和沙縣小吃,你們還在等什麼。

小編結語
以上洋洋灑灑介紹了牛大坊/包菜網絡科技的應用案例,相信老財對數據可視化解決方案的選型思路對各位也有所啟發,特別是選型過程中發現的DataV對於企業運營數據分析的強大威力,感興趣的話趕緊去 DataV 數據可視化裏試試吧。
https://data.aliyun.com/visual/datav?spm=5176.8142029.388261.74.tPZdRK

另注DataV的最新動向:**DataV接入ECharts圖表庫 可視化利器強強聯手**TB1WjR2RVXXXXXqXFXXXXXXXXXX_750_400
速速前往現場了解:https://yq.aliyun.com/articles/106656?spm=5176.100244.teamhomeleft.2.hGi0Sv

最後更新:2017-06-29 21:34:09

  上一篇:go  Deepgreen & Greenplum 高可用(二) - Master故障轉移
  下一篇:go  阿裏雲資源編排服務 Java SDK使用入門